Enterprise Software Development Services

We recognize the intricate challenges of enterprise software development. When your organization faces mission-critical projects that require seamless transitions with zero downtime, strict adherence to global compliance standards, and robust defenses against advanced threats, Cybervision is the partner you can trust to deliver excellence.

Our Enterprise Software Development Services

Custom Enterprise Software Development

Our team of experts uses a diverse range of programming languages, frameworks, and libraries to deliver robust front-end and back-end solutions.

By following Agile and DevOps best practices, we build enterprise-grade software from scratch, equipping it with customized modules and features tailored to your unique needs.

Enterprise Mobile App Development

Transform your systems into mobile-friendly solutions to boost productivity and keep your team efficient, regardless of their location.

All while maintaining top-notch security.

Enterprise Big Data Services

Empower your decision-making processes by unlocking actionable insights from your data.

We provide onsite, cloud, and hybrid big data solutions that are efficient, cost-effective, and easy to manage.

Helping you stay ahead in the data-driven age.

IT Consulting

Our IT consulting services assist organizations in implementing custom enterprise software and navigating potential adoption challenges.

We provide guidance on identifying suitable use cases, selecting the optimal tech stack and deployment model, estimating TCO and ROI, and creating a realistic project roadmap to ensure success.

Technical Audit

We conduct in-depth technical audits to examine the core components, technology stack, and operational aspects of your enterprise software.

Our audits identify design and security vulnerabilities, provide actionable recommendations, and ensure alignment with industry standards and best practices.

Software Integration Services

Simplify your operations by connecting disparate systems to streamline workflows.

We design secure data handoffs and develop custom applications to centralize access, making your existing software more efficient and integrated.

Software Maintenance

Our software maintenance services cover adaptive, perfective, corrective, and preventive needs.

We ensure your enterprise software evolves with new usage scenarios, resolves performance issues, and prevents latent faults from disrupting your operations.

Enterprise Software Integration

Cybervision seamlessly integrates your enterprise software with corporate systems and IoT networks.

Using APIs, message-oriented middleware, ETL/ELT data synchronization, and iPaaS solutions, we eliminate data silos and ensure an uninterrupted flow of information across your technology ecosystem.

Software Testing and QA Consulting

Our experienced QA professionals deliver high-grade software testing and QA consulting services.

Leveraging both manual and automated testing methodologies, we ensure your software’s reliability, performance, and functionality.

Guaranteeing flawless product delivery.

Enterprise Cloud Solution

Our cloud specialists collaborate with enterprise software experts to provide scalable, flexible, and cost-efficient cloud solutions.

From migration and deployment to ongoing management of your business applications and IT infrastructure, we enable innovation, agility, and growth using the latest in cloud computing technology.

Advanced technologies for enterprise software

Artificial Intelligence

We integrate multiple branches of AI, such as machine learning, computer vision, and natural language processing, to develop custom systems. These systems excel in detecting patterns and anomalies in big data, learning from experience to enhance their operational capabilities, deriving insights from visual inputs, and enabling seamless human/machine interactions.

Internet of Things (IoT)

Our team specializes in configuring and deploying extensive networks of interconnected devices, such as RFID tags, sensors, beacons, and wearables. These networks collect real-time data for analytical and operational purposes, supporting use cases like remote patient monitoring in healthcare, track-and-trace in logistics, and predictive maintenance in transportation.

Robotic Process Automation (RPA)

We deploy RPA bots across your business processes to automate repetitive tasks or assist your workforce with administrative operations. From claim processing in insurance to bank reconciliation in accounting or payroll management in HR, our RPA solutions improve efficiency while reducing manual workloads.

Blockchain

Cybervision enables your organization to leverage blockchain technology for transparent and secure transactions. From self-executing smart contracts to asset tracking in supply chains and streamlined anti-money laundering (AML) and KYC processes via incorruptible data storage, our solutions bring trust and efficiency to your operations.

Data Science

For businesses handling vast amounts of data, our data science expertise offers tools and frameworks to optimize operations and accelerate decision-making. Leverage our solutions to uncover insights, automate analytics, and improve overall efficiency.

Low-Code/No-Code Development

We assist in developing enterprise applications using low-code/no-code platforms. With intuitive tools like drag-and-drop interfaces and pull-down menus, your company can quickly build, deploy, and scale applications without requiring extensive coding knowledge.

Cloud Computing

Our cloud consulting services help you leverage platforms like Azure, AWS, and Google Cloud to create a flexible, scalable, and interconnected business environment. With our guidance, you can ensure seamless integration and management of all your cloud-based operations.

TOOLS & TECHNOLOGIES OUR SOFTWARE DEVELOPERS USE

Our team utilizes a robust set of tools, state-of-the-art technologies, and modern methods to deliver exceptional software solutions that drive business growth and innovation. Here's a glimpse of the technical stack we rely on for successful project delivery:

Back-end

Python Java Ruby PHP C# Node.js Go Kotlin Rust Scala .NET

Front-end

HTML CSS JavaScript TypeScript React.js Angular Vue.js Bootstrap Sass/SCSS

Desktop

Java C# C++ Python Electron Qt WinForms GTK+ Swift

Mobile

Swift Objective-C Java Kotlin React Native Flutter Xamarin Ionic PhoneGap Cardova Unity Accelerator Titanium

Big Data

Hadoop Apache Spark Apache Kafka Apache HBase Apache Cassandra MongoDB Apache Hive Apache Pig Apache Storm Elasticsearch

AI/ML

ML-Agents ChatBot TensorFlow DialogFlow PyTorch Scikit-learn Microsoft Azure ML Studio IBM Watson Studio Hadoop

Data Analytics & Visualization

Power BI Tableau Qlik Google Data Studio Domo Apache Superset SAS Visual Analytics Unity Analytics

Devops

Kubernetes Helm Terraform Docker Ansible Chef Puppet vCenter Server vSphere VMware Tanzu VMware ESXi GitLab Jenkins GitHub Actions Bitbucket Grafana Prometheus ELK (Elasticsearch, Logstash, Kibana) New Relic, Splunk Amazon Web Services (AWS) Google Cloud Azure OpenStack

Monitoring

Grafana Prometheus ELK New Relic Splunk

Why choose us?

With a customer retention ratio exceeding 90%, we pride ourselves on fostering lasting client relationships. Whether your goal is to develop scalable software solutions that optimize internal processes or integrate applications for a connected software ecosystem, we’re here to help. Utilize our enterprise application development services to bridge resource gaps, unlock hidden potential, and streamline your business operations for sustained growth.

Digital Automation

Our business analysts conduct in-depth research to craft tailored automation solutions that align with your specific goals. From initial estimations to detailed specifications and project scoping, we deliver a clear roadmap for automating business processes efficiently and effectively.

Superior Technical Proficiency

Our cross-functional teams of engineers, analysts, solutions architects, and testing experts work collaboratively to deliver consistent results. By addressing challenges at every level, they minimize technical risks with strategic architecture design and ensure complete transparency throughout the project lifecycle.

Full-Stack Team for Project Success

Our comprehensive team includes business analysts, UX/UI designers, software developers, QA engineers, and DevOps specialists, all experienced in custom enterprise app development. From custom integrations to complete software development, we handle every aspect of your project seamlessly under one roof, ensuring exceptional outcomes.

Our Enterprise Software Development Cycle

01

Design Stage

Our design team crafts user-centric designs that reflect your brand identity while ensuring an engaging and intuitive user experience. We focus on creating interfaces that combine aesthetics with functionality to enhance user satisfaction.

02

Development Process

Using the latest technologies and agile methodologies, we develop your software with a focus on scalability, efficiency, and robustness. Best practices guide every step, ensuring the solution meets your current needs while adapting to future growth.

03

Support & Maintenance

Our partnership doesn’t end with deployment. We offer ongoing support, regular updates, and maintenance to ensure your software remains secure, efficient, and aligned with your evolving requirements.

04

Smooth Deployment

Deploying enterprise solutions requires precision. We manage the transition seamlessly, ensuring legacy systems remain operational while integrating new applications effectively to minimize disruption.

05

Rigorous Testing

Quality assurance is embedded into every step of our development process. Through continuous testing and comprehensive QA procedures, we validate functionality, reliability, and performance long before your solution goes live.

FAQ

What are the advantages of custom enterprise software compared to off-the-shelf solutions?

Off-the-shelf solutions are often ideal for small businesses seeking quick deployment and cost savings, even if they sacrifice some efficiency.

However, at the enterprise level, efficiency and customization are paramount. Custom enterprise software is built to address unique business needs, ensuring scalability, seamless integration, and a tailored fit for complex workflows.

Hybrid approaches, combining ready-made modules with custom features, can also be an effective option.

How is enterprise software different from other software systems?

Enterprise software is designed to address specific, often complex, organizational needs.

It supports a company’s strategic goals by solving intricate challenges, streamlining processes, and integrating with third-party systems.

Unlike general-purpose software, enterprise solutions are tailored to meet precise business objectives, are highly scalable, secure, and reliable, and often serve multiple stakeholders across the organization.

What are the key benefits of adopting enterprise software?

Adopting enterprise software can significantly enhance efficiency and productivity.

It simplifies complex tasks, automates workflows, and saves both time and resources.

Additionally, it brings transparency, traceability, and standardization to business processes, enabling better compliance and oversight.

Enterprise software also supports scalability, ensuring consistent quality as the organization grows.

How much does enterprise software development cost?

The cost of enterprise software development varies based on several factors, including the complexity of the project, software size, design intricacy, required integrations, team expertise, and location.

Timelines also influence costs. For a detailed estimate tailored to your needs, reach out to us for a free quote.

How long does it take to develop enterprise application software?

The timeline for developing enterprise software depends on multiple factors, such as the complexity of the solution, desired features, functionality, and end-user requirements.

From initial planning to final testing and release, a full-cycle project can take several months to a year, depending on the scope.

Do you ensure NDA and intellectual property protection for my project?

Absolutely. You retain 100% ownership of your project.

This includes NDAs, copyright, source code, intellectual property rights, confidential agreements, and any other necessary documentation.

Can a dedicated Project Manager or Scrum Master be assigned to my project?

Yes, we can assign a dedicated Project Manager or Scrum Master to oversee your project.

This individual will serve as your primary point of contact, ensuring smooth communication and providing support for any questions or issues that arise.

Do you provide app maintenance and support services?

Yes, we offer comprehensive app maintenance and support services.

Our experts handle ongoing monitoring, bug fixes, performance optimization, security updates, and regular enhancements to ensure your application continues to operate smoothly and meets evolving business needs.